I had one for a while...an original made by Paul that I purchased off Craigslist.  Bow was a 62" recurve with two sets of limbs - both camo.  One set was the original set that was purchased with the bow and the second set was from a duplicate "backup" bow that the original owner had purchased, but he had since lost the second riser.

I tried and tried to adjust to the bow, but the grip just did not fit me and I couldn't become consistent with it.  I eventually sold it to another tradgang member with both sets of limbs.
